What Does the Thyroglobulin Immunohistochemistry Test Measure?

This advanced diagnostic test specifically detects and visualizes thyroglobulin protein expression within thyroid tissue specimens. Thyroglobulin serves as a critical biomarker for thyroid follicular cells, and its presence or absence provides essential diagnostic information:

  • Identifies thyroglobulin protein expression patterns in thyroid tissue
  • Differentiates between thyroid carcinoma types (papillary, follicular)
  • Detects metastatic thyroid cancer cells in lymph nodes or other tissues
  • Assesses tumor differentiation and aggressiveness
  • Provides visual confirmation of thyroid origin in uncertain cases

Understanding Your Test Results

Interpreting thyroglobulin immunohistochemistry results requires professional medical expertise, but general understanding includes:

Positive Thyroglobulin Staining

Strong, diffuse cytoplasmic staining typically indicates well-differentiated thyroid carcinoma, suggesting favorable prognosis and potential responsiveness to radioactive iodine treatment.

Negative or Focal Staining

Absent or limited thyroglobulin expression may suggest poorly differentiated thyroid cancer, requiring more aggressive treatment approaches and closer monitoring.

Pattern Interpretation

Staining patterns provide additional diagnostic information, with specific distributions helping differentiate between various thyroid pathology subtypes and guiding appropriate management strategies.

Sample Requirements and Processing Timeline

For optimal results, please ensure proper sample preparation and submission:

  • Sample Type: Submit tumor tissue in 10% formal-saline OR formalin-fixed paraffin-embedded block
  • Shipping: Transport at room temperature with appropriate packaging
  • Documentation: Provide complete histopathology report, biopsy site details, and clinical history
  • Turnaround Time: Standard blocks: 5 days | Tissue biopsy: 5 days | Complex tissue: 7 days
